
Muhammad Ichwan
Muhammad Ichwan is the Executive Director of the National Independent Forest Monitoring Network (JPIK), where he focuses on the impact of governmental policies on natural resource management. He has been vocal about the negative consequences of deregulation on environmental protection and advocates for more sustainable practices to prevent disasters such as the recent flooding in Sumatra.
